Latest Patents
Shaorui Jing holds a patent for an "Anti-corrosion and low-heat-conduction annulus protection fluid for deep-sea oil and gas exploitation and preparation method thereof." This innovative fluid comprises a polymer solution, clear water, a thermally-insulating material, a corrosion inhibitor, and xanthan gum. The formulation is designed to exhibit excellent thermal insulation performance and corrosion resistance, effectively preventing the generation of hydrates and the decomposition of hydrate layers at a wellhead.
